8,669,480 is a composite number, even.
8,669,480 (eight million six hundred sixty-nine thousand four hundred eighty) is an even 7-digit number. It is a composite number with 32 divisors, and factors as 2³ × 5 × 73 × 2,969. Its proper divisors sum to 11,110,720,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x844928.
